Confronting Tracker Field Quintessence with Data

Abstract

We confront tracker field quintessence with observational data. The potentials considered in this paper include V(ϕ)ϕαV(\phi)\propto\phi^{-\alpha}, exp(Mp/ϕ)\exp(M_{p}/\phi), exp(Mp/ϕ)1\exp(M_{p}/\phi)-1, exp(βMp/ϕ)\exp(\beta M_{p}/\phi) and exp(γMp/ϕ)1\exp(\gamma M_{p}/\phi)-1; while the data come from the latest SN Ia, CMB and BAO observations. Stringent parameter constraints are obtained. In comparison with the cosmological constant via information criteria, it is found that models with potentials exp(Mp/ϕ)\exp(M_{p}/\phi), exp(Mp/ϕ)1\exp(M_{p}/\phi)-1 and exp(γMp/ϕ)1\exp(\gamma M_{p}/\phi)-1 are not supported by the current data.
